Small Town Coffee is a charming coffee shop located at 4-1613 Kuhio Hwy, Kapaa, Hawaii. With its cozy atmosphere and warm vibes, it is the perfect place to enjoy a delicious cup of coffee or tea. Whether you are a local resident or a tourist visiting Kapaa, Small Town Coffee offers an inviting setting to relax and unwind.

Their menu features an extensive selection of coffee and tea options, catering to all tastes. From classic drip coffee to specialty lattes and exotic loose-leaf teas, there is something for everyone. Don't forget to try their signature drinks for a unique and flavorful experience.

In addition to their beverage offerings, Small Town Coffee also serves tasty pastries and light snacks, perfect for accompanying your drink of choice. The friendly and knowledgeable staff ensures excellent customer service, making your visit pleasant and enjoyable.

Located in a peaceful small town setting, Small Town Coffee promises a delightful coffee shop experience. So, whether you are looking for a morning pick-me-up or a place to catch up with friends, Small Town Coffee is worth a visit.
